Soulmask Server-FAQ
Die wichtigsten FAQs zur Soulmask-Serververwaltung. Erfahre alles über Konfiguration, Spielstände, Admin-Tools, Mods und Verbindungen.
Dieses Dokument bietet detaillierte Antworten zur Verwaltung deines Soulmask-Gameservers. Es deckt die Serverkonfiguration, Spielstände, Modding, Konnektivität, Admin-Tools und mehr ab.
🔢 Welche Soulmask-Version läuft auf meinem Server?
Standardmäßig wird dein Soulmask-Server immer auf die neueste stabile Version aktualisiert. Ein Downgrade oder die Auswahl älterer Versionen wird nicht unterstützt.
⚙️ Wie konfiguriere ich meinen Soulmask-Server?
Soulmask verwendet zwei Hauptkonfigurationsdateien:
Engine.ini: Zu finden unter/Server/WS/Saved/Config/WindowsServer/Engine.ini. Steuert das allgemeine Serververhalten.GameXishu.json: Zu finden unter/Server/WS/Saved/GameplaySettings/GameXishu.json. Diese Datei regelt die Gameplay-Einstellungen, ähnlich wie die Sandbox-Optionen. Um die Sandbox-Einstellungen (im Spiel „Koeffizienten“ genannt) anzupassen, bearbeite diese Datei oder nutze das Admin-Menü im Spiel.
⚠️ Die Engine.ini muss über den Konfigurations-Manager bearbeitet werden. Manuelle Änderungen via FTP oder Dateimanager werden beim Serverneustart überschrieben.
🗂️ Was bedeuten die Konfigurationskategorien in GameXishu.json?
Die Konfigurationsdatei verwendet die numerischen Abschnitte "0", "1" und "2", die wahrscheinlich für verschiedene Spielmodi stehen (z. B. offiziell, benutzerdefiniert, PvE). Darin sind die Einstellungen wie folgt kategorisiert:
Hier ist eine Übersicht darüber, was die Werte bedeuten:
🔢 Abschnitte:
"0","1","2"Dies sind wahrscheinlich verschiedene Server-Modi, vermutlich:
"0"= Offiziell/Standard"1"= Benutzerdefiniert oder eingeschränkt"2"= PvE-fokussiert oder Event📘 ALLGEMEINE KATEGORIEN:
📈 EP & WACHSTUM
ExpRatio: Basis-ErfahrungsmultiplikatorChengZhangExpRatio,MJExpRatio,ShuLianDuExpRatiousw.: Verschiedene Arten von EP-Gewinnen (Wachstum, Beruf, Fertigkeit)MaxLevel: Maximales Charakterlevel (standardmäßig 60)ZuoWuShengZhangRatio,DongWuShengZhangRatio: Wachstumsgeschwindigkeit von Pflanzen/Tieren💎 RESSOURCEN- & DROP-RATEN
CaiJiDiaoLuoRatio,FaMuDiaoLuoRatio,CaiKuangDiaoLuoRatio: Drop-Raten für Sammeln, Holzfällen, BergbauBossRenDiaoLuoRatio,JingYingRenDiaoLuoRatio,PuTongRenDiaoLuoRatio: Beute-Drop-Raten für verschiedene NPC-TypenBaoXiangDropRatio: Truhen-Drop-RateZuoWuDropRatio: ErnteertragsrateTeShuDaoJuDropXiShuJiaChengKaiGuan: Aktivierung des Drop-Boosts für Spezialgegenstände⚔️ KAMPF & SCHADEN
DamageYeShengRatio,BeDamageByYeShengRatio: Ausgeteilter/erlittener Schaden durch wilde MonsterPVP_ShangHaiRatio_*: PvP-Schadensverhältnisse (Nahkampf, Fernkampf, Spieler-zu-Spieler)HuXIangShangHaiKaiGuan: Aktivierung von gegenseitigem Schaden (PvP Friendly Fire)WanJiaHitJianZhuShangHaiRatio: Spielerschaden an GebäudenYeShengHitJianZhuShangHaiRatio: Schaden durch wilde Tiere an Gebäuden
RollingInvincibleTimeRatio: Dauer der Unverwundbarkeit beim Rollen/Ausweichen🧍♂️ NPC- & KREATUREN-LIMITS
GongHuiMaxDongWuCount,GeRenMaxDongWuCount: Maximales Tierlimit für Gilden/EinzelspielerGongHuiMaxSpecDongWuCount: Gildenlimit für SpezialtiereAnimalFollowerMaxCount: Maximale Anzahl an BegleiternManRenChuZhanCount: Anzahl der eingesetzten humanoiden Verbündeten🧱 GEBÄUDE
JianZhuFuLanMul,JianZhuXiuLiMul: Modifikatoren für Gebäudeschaden & -reparaturJianZhuGaoDuLimit: Maximale GebäudehöheJianZhuMirageKaiGuan: Aktivierung von IllusionsgebäudenKaiQiJianZhuHuiXueBuilding: Aktivierung von Gebäuden mit Lebensregeneration🔄 RESPAWN & WIEDERBELEBUNG
FuHuoMoveSiWangBaoKaiGuan: Aktivierung von Respawn-bei-BewegungZhiBeiChongShengRatio: Wiederbelebungsrate⏰ WELTZEIT
GameWorldDayTimePortion: Anteil des Tages, der Tageslicht ist (0.7 = 70 %)GameWorldTimePower: Multiplikator für die Dauer eines Spieltages🛡️ RAID / INVASION
RuQinKaiGuan: Invasionsmodus aktivierenRuQinGuaiCountMin/Max: Minimale/maximale Anzahl an AngreifernRuQinBeginHour/EndHour: Zeitfenster für InvasionenRuQinShaoChengXiShu,RuQinTuShaXiShu: Raid-Strafen/Modifikatoren🗺️ ERKUNDUNG & EVENTS
TribalExplorationKaiGuan,RuinsExplorationKaiGuan: Aktivierung von ErkundungenSpecialEventSwitch,BossDeathEventSwitchusw.: Steuerung von Event-TypenSpecialEventTriggerInterval: Zeitspanne zwischen möglichen Event-TriggernSpecialEventTriggerPercent: Wahrscheinlichkeit für das Auftreten eines Events
SpecialEventTriggetLimitNum: Maximale Anzahl gleichzeitig aktiver Events⚙️ CRAFTING, REPARATUR & GEGENSTANDSVERFALL
ZhiZuoTimeRatio: Modifikator für die HerstellungszeitWuPinFuHuaiRatio,WuPinXiaoHuiTime: Verfallsrate von Gegenständen & Zerstörungs-TimerXiuLiXuYaoCaiLiaoRatio: Verhältnis der Materialkosten für Reparaturen💼 INVENTAR & LIMITS
RoleBagCapacity: InventarplätzeMaxFuZhongRatio: Maximales TraglastverhältnisGeRenBiaoJiMaxCount,GongHuiBiaoJiMaxCount: Maximale Kartenmarkierungen🏹 PvP-STEUERUNG
HuXIangShangHaiKaiGuan: Friendly FirePlayerYouFangShangHaiKaiGuan,YouFangShangHaiKaiGuan: Schaden innerhalb derselben GruppeKaiQiKuaFu: Serverübergreifendes PvP aktivieren/deaktivierenWarKaiGuan: PvP-Kriegs-Events aktivieren💬 SOZIALES / GILDE
GongHuiMaxMember: Maximale GildenmitgliederGeRenMaxZhaoMuCount,GongHuiMaxZhaoMuCount: Maximale Anzahl an Beschwörungen/RekrutierungenTransDoorInterworkKaiGuan: Gebietsübergreifende Teleportation🌍 UMGEBUNG
XiuMianDistance,HuanXingDistance: Distanz für Ruhezustand/AufwachenWuLiYouHuaKaiGuan: Physik-Optimierung aktivieren/deaktivierenMovementYouHua: Bewegungs-Optimierung aktivieren/deaktivieren🟢 HAUPTUNTERSCHIEDE ZWISCHEN
"0","1","2"Einige Optionen sind in
"1"oder"2"deaktiviert (z. B.JianZhuChuanSongMenPlusKaiGuan)"1"erlaubt weniger einsetzbare Verbündete (ManRenChuZhanCount= 1 statt 3)"1"und"2"setzen beideConverPropsSpeedRatioauf5(was wahrscheinlich bestimmte Prozesse beschleunigt), während"0"den Wert1nutzt"1"erlaubt weniger Spezialtiere als"0"oder"2"
Nochmal zur Erinnerung: Die einzige Möglichkeit, die Sandbox-Einstellungen (im Spiel „Koeffizienten“ genannt) anzupassen, ist über das Admin-Menü im Spiel.
💾 Wie werden Spielstände (Saves) verwaltet?
Spielstände werden hier gespeichert:/Server/WS/Saved/Worlds/Dedicated/Level01_Main/world.db
Du kannst einen Einzelspieler-Spielstand oder ein Save von einem anderen Anbieter wie folgt hochladen:
- Stoppe den Server.
- Lösche die vorhandene
world.db. - Ersetze sie durch deine gesicherte Spieldatei.
Um im Spiel manuell zu speichern (als Admin), nutze folgenden Befehl:
gm BaoCun🔑 Wie werde ich Admin?
- Drücke die Tilde-Taste
~(zweimal, um die Konsole zu vergrößern; das Tastaturlayout muss auf Englisch eingestellt sein). Nutze den Befehl:
gm key- Das Passwort wird in den Basiseinstellungen (Basic Settings) festgelegt.
🔒 Wie kann ich Spieler bannen oder entbannen?
Sobald du Admin bist:
Zum Bannen:
gm AddServerPermissionList 1Zum Entbannen:
gm RemoveServerPermissionList 1
💬 Welche Admin-Befehle gibt es?
| Befehl | Beschreibung |
|---|---|
gm key [password] | GM/Admin-Menü öffnen |
gm AddExp [value] | Charakter-EP hinzufügen |
gm Addmjexp [value] | Masken-EP hinzufügen |
gm Addshoulieexp [value] | Jagd-EP hinzufügen |
gm XiDian | Statuspunkte zurücksetzen |
gm ZiSha 1 | Selbstmord begehen |
gm FuHuo | Wiederbeleben |
gm shanhao | Account löschen |
GPS | Eigene Position anzeigen |
gm ZhaoMu | Anvisierten NPC rekrutieren |
gm Go [x] [y] [z] | Zu Koordinaten teleportieren |
gm ClearAllNpc | Alle NPCs despawnen |
gm ClearSelect | Ausgewählten NPC oder Gegenstand despawnen |
gm ShuaXinZhiBei | Vegetation in der Nähe aktualisieren |
gm ShowInfo 1/0 | Infos über sich selbst/andere anzeigen |
gm SetAttr YinShen 1/0 | Unsichtbarkeit aktivieren/deaktivieren |
gm JSMJ | Maskenknoten reparieren |
gm ShowMap | Alle Orte auf der Karte aufdecken |
gm KeJiShu | Technologiebaum freischalten |
gm ShowReDu | Invasions-Heatmap anzeigen |
gm ClearAllReDu | Gesamte Invasions-Hitze zurücksetzen |
gm AddReDu [value] | Invasions-Hitze im Gebiet erhöhen |
gm ChongZhiRenWu | Tutorial-Missionen zurücksetzen |
Debuginfo 1/0 | Server-Performance-Infos anzeigen/ausblenden |
🧩 Wie installiere ich Mods?
- Trage die Steam Workshop Mod-IDs in das Feld Mods in den Basiseinstellungen (Basic Settings) ein.
Trenne die IDs jeweils mit einem Komma und ohne Leerzeichen, zum Beispiel:
3325034091,3400177243- Spieler müssen die Mods ebenfalls über ihr In-Game-Mod-Menü installieren und aktivieren, um beitreten zu können.
🌐 Wie verbinde ich mich mit dem Server?
Es gibt zwei Möglichkeiten, einem Soulmask-Server beizutreten:
- Direktverbindung (Direct Connect):
Nutze die IP-Adresse und den Port des Servers, um dich direkt zu verbinden. - Serverliste (über das Feld „Einladungscode“ / „Invitation Code“):
Öffne die Serverliste im Spiel und gib den exakten Namen deines Servers oben rechts in das Feld „Einladungscode“ ein.
Dadurch wird gezielt nach deinem Server gesucht und dieser angezeigt, selbst wenn er nicht öffentlich gelistet ist.
✅ Stelle sicher, dass der Servername exakt mit dem Namen übereinstimmt, den du in den Basiseinstellungen (Basic Settings) festgelegt hast.
📄 Kann ich Konfigurationsdateien via FTP anpassen?
Nicht direkt. Änderungen an der Engine.ini müssen über den Konfigurations-Manager vorgenommen werden, da sie sonst beim Neustart überschrieben werden.
🛠️ Kann ich einen Spielstand von einem anderen Server hochladen?
Ja. Lade eine kompatible world.db-Datei in folgendes Verzeichnis hoch:
/Server/WS/Saved/Worlds/Dedicated/Level01_Main/Starte den Server anschließend neu, um den Spielstand zu laden.
Kann ich RCON auf diesem Server nutzen?
Ja, RCON ist mit den Soulmask-Servern von PingPlayers kompatibel. Dazu musst du die IP-Adresse, von der aus die RCON-Verbindung hergestellt wird, in einer Zeile der Engine.ini auf die Whitelist setzen und den Server neu starten. Danach kannst du dich über IP:RCON-PORT und das RCON-Passwort verbinden, um Befehle auszuführen. Es können mehrere IPs hinzugefügt werden, falls mehrere Spieler RCON nutzen möchten (entferne dabei nicht die erste Zeile IP=179.19.0.1).
[Server.SafeIP]
IP=179.19.0.1
IP=YOUR PUBLIC IP 1
IP=YOUR PUBLIC IP 2⚠️ Bekannte Probleme
- Die Admin-Konsole funktioniert nur mit englischem Tastaturlayout.
- Fehlerhaft bearbeitete Konfigurationsdateien werden zurückgesetzt oder können den Serverstart verhindern.
- Wenn Mods nicht clientseitig (beim Spieler) installiert sind, schlägt die Verbindung fehl.
- Admin-Befehle achten auf Groß-/Kleinschreibung und korrekte Leerzeichen.